A graphical application, based on the .NET Framework, which checks the health of a DirectAccess client by running various tests.
The DirectAccess Client Troubleshooting Tool is a graphical application designed to check the health of a DirectAccess client by running various diagnostic tests. It provides IT professionals and network administrators with a comprehensive solution to identify and resolve issues affecting DirectAccess functionality.
Key Features:
- Built-in health checks for network interfaces, IP connectivity (including 6to4, Teredo, and IPHTTPS), Windows Firewall configurations, certificates, and IPsec tunnels.
- Detailed analysis of DNS, NLS (Network Location Server), NRPT (Network Restriction Platform), and certificate trust chains to ensure proper client authentication and communication.
- Option to run post-check scripts (PowerShell, VBScript, BAT, or CMD files) for advanced troubleshooting and automation.

The tool is compatible with Windows 7, Windows 8, and Windows 8.1, requiring .NET Framework 4 Client Profile for Windows 7. It can be installed via winget for easy deployment across managed environments.
